Natural voice conversations for AI assistants. Voice Mode brings human-like voice interactions to Claude Code, AI code editors through the Model Context Protocol (MCP).

## 🖥️ Compatibility

**Runs on:** Linux • macOS • Windows (WSL) • NixOS | **Python:** 3.10+

## ✨ Features

- **🎙️ Voice conversations** with Claude - ask questions and hear responses
- **🔄 Multiple transports** - local microphone or LiveKit room-based communication  
- **🗣️ OpenAI-compatible** - works with any STT/TTS service (local or cloud)
- **⚡ Real-time** - low-latency voice interactions with automatic transport selection
- **🔧 MCP Integration** - seamless with Claude Desktop and other MCP clients
- **🎯 Silence detection** - automatically stops recording when you stop speaking (no more waiting!)

## Installation

### Prerequisites
- Python >= 3.10
- [Astral UV](https://github.com/astral-sh/uv) - Package manager (install with `curl -LsSf https://astral.sh/uv/install.sh | sh`)
- OpenAI API Key (or compatible service)

#### System Dependencies

<details>
<summary><strong>Ubuntu/Debian</strong></summary>

```bash
sudo apt update
sudo apt install -y python3-dev libasound2-dev libasound2-plugins libportaudio2 portaudio19-dev ffmpeg pulseaudio pulseaudio-utils
```

**Note for WSL2 users**: WSL2 requires additional audio packages (pulseaudio, libasound2-plugins) for microphone access. See our [WSL2 Microphone Access Guide](docs/troubleshooting/wsl2-microphone-access.md) if you encounter issues.
</details>

<details>
<summary><strong>Fedora/RHEL</strong></summary>

```bash
sudo dnf install python3-devel alsa-lib-devel portaudio-devel ffmpeg
```
</details>

<details>
<summary><strong>macOS</strong></summary>

```bash
# Install Homebrew if not already installed
/bin/bash -c "$(curl -fsSL https://raw.githubusercontent.com/Homebrew/install/HEAD/install.sh)"

# Install dependencies
brew install portaudio ffmpeg cmake
```
</details>

<details>
<summary><strong>Windows (WSL)</strong></summary>

Follow the Ubuntu/Debian instructions above within WSL.
</details>

## Tools

| Tool | Description | Key Parameters |
|------|-------------|----------------|
| `converse` | Have a voice conversation - speak and optionally listen | `message`, `wait_for_response` (default: true), `listen_duration` (default: 30s), `transport` (auto/local/livekit) |
| `listen_for_speech` | Listen for speech and convert to text | `duration` (default: 5s) |
| `check_room_status` | Check LiveKit room status and participants | None |
| `check_audio_devices` | List available audio input/output devices | None |
| `start_kokoro` | Start the Kokoro TTS service | `models_dir` (optional, defaults to ~/Models/kokoro) |
| `stop_kokoro` | Stop the Kokoro TTS service | None |
| `kokoro_status` | Check the status of Kokoro TTS service | None |
| `install_whisper_cpp` | Install whisper.cpp for local STT | `install_dir`, `model` (default: base.en), `use_gpu` (auto-detect) |
| `install_kokoro_fastapi` | Install kokoro-fastapi for local TTS | `install_dir`, `port` (default: 8880), `auto_start` (default: true) |

**Note:** The `converse` tool is the primary interface for voice interactions, combining speaking and listening in a natural flow.

**New:** The `install_whisper_cpp` and `install_kokoro_fastapi` tools help you set up free, private, open-source voice services locally. See [Installation Tools Documentation](docs/installation-tools.md) for detailed usage.

### Optional Settings

```bash
# Custom STT/TTS services (OpenAI-compatible)
export STT_BASE_URL="http://127.0.0.1:2022/v1"  # Local Whisper
export TTS_BASE_URL="http://127.0.0.1:8880/v1"  # Local TTS
export TTS_VOICE="alloy"                        # Voice selection

# Or use voice preference files (see Configuration docs)
# Project: /your-project/voices.txt or /your-project/.voicemode/voices.txt
# User: ~/voices.txt or ~/.voicemode/voices.txt

# LiveKit (for room-based communication)
# See docs/livekit/ for setup guide
export LIVEKIT_URL="wss://your-app.livekit.cloud"
export LIVEKIT_API_KEY="your-api-key"
export LIVEKIT_API_SECRET="your-api-secret"

# Debug mode
export VOICEMODE_DEBUG="true"

# Save all audio (TTS output and STT input)
export VOICEMODE_SAVE_AUDIO="true"

# Audio format configuration (default: pcm)
export VOICEMODE_AUDIO_FORMAT="pcm"         # Options: pcm, mp3, wav, flac, aac, opus
export VOICEMODE_TTS_AUDIO_FORMAT="pcm"     # Override for TTS only (default: pcm)
export VOICEMODE_STT_AUDIO_FORMAT="mp3"     # Override for STT upload

# Format-specific quality settings
export VOICEMODE_OPUS_BITRATE="32000"       # Opus bitrate (default: 32kbps)
export VOICEMODE_MP3_BITRATE="64k"          # MP3 bitrate (default: 64k)
```

### Audio Format Configuration

Voice Mode uses **PCM** audio format by default for TTS streaming for optimal real-time performance:

- **PCM** (default for TTS): Zero latency, best streaming performance, uncompressed
- **MP3**: Wide compatibility, good compression for uploads
- **WAV**: Uncompressed, good for local processing
- **FLAC**: Lossless compression, good for archival
- **AAC**: Good compression, Apple ecosystem
- **Opus**: Small files but NOT recommended for streaming (quality issues)

The audio format is automatically validated against provider capabilities and will fallback to a supported format if needed.

## Local STT/TTS Services

For privacy-focused or offline usage, Voice Mode supports local speech services:

- **[Whisper.cpp](docs/whisper.cpp.md)** - Local speech-to-text with OpenAI-compatible API
- **[Kokoro](docs/kokoro.md)** - Local text-to-speech with multiple voice options

These services provide the same API interface as OpenAI, allowing seamless switching between cloud and local processing.

### OpenAI API Compatibility Benefits

By strictly adhering to OpenAI's API standard, Voice Mode enables powerful deployment flexibility:

- **🔀 Transparent Routing**: Users can implement their own API proxies or gateways outside of Voice Mode to route requests to different providers based on custom logic (cost, latency, availability, etc.)
- **🎯 Model Selection**: Deploy routing layers that select optimal models per request without modifying Voice Mode configuration
- **💰 Cost Optimization**: Build intelligent routers that balance between expensive cloud APIs and free local models
- **🔧 No Lock-in**: Switch providers by simply changing the `BASE_URL` - no code changes required

Example: Simply set `OPENAI_BASE_URL` to point to your custom router:
```bash
export OPENAI_BASE_URL="https://router.example.com/v1"
export OPENAI_API_KEY="your-key"
# Voice Mode now uses your router for all OpenAI API calls
```

The OpenAI SDK handles this automatically - no Voice Mode configuration needed!

## Troubleshooting

### Common Issues

- **No microphone access**: Check system permissions for terminal/application
  - **WSL2 Users**: See [WSL2 Microphone Access Guide](docs/troubleshooting/wsl2-microphone-access.md)
- **UV not found**: Install with `curl -LsSf https://astral.sh/uv/install.sh | sh`
- **OpenAI API error**: Verify your `OPENAI_API_KEY` is set correctly
- **No audio output**: Check system audio settings and available devices

### Debug Mode

Enable detailed logging and audio file saving:

```bash
export VOICEMODE_DEBUG=true
```

Debug audio files are saved to: `~/voicemode_recordings/`

### Audio Diagnostics

Run the diagnostic script to check your audio setup:

```bash
python scripts/diagnose-wsl-audio.py
```

This will check for required packages, audio services, and provide specific recommendations.

### Audio Saving

To save all audio files (both TTS output and STT input):

```bash
export VOICEMODE_SAVE_AUDIO=true
```

Audio files are saved to: `~/voicemode_audio/` with timestamps in the filename.
